Connor Treacey

3rd May 2006 1.89m/103kg Openside Flanker

Born in Lymington, Treacey attended Priestlands School and currently studies Sports
Management and Coaching at Bath University. New Milton RFC was where he started out in
rugby, looking up to the likes of Ardie Savea before joining the Bath Rugby academy at U15
level.
He cites former Bath academy coach and current England pathway scrum coach, Nathan Catt,
as his most influential coach. Connor won the 2024 Premiership Rugby U18 Academy League
with the Somerset side.
The 19-year-old has progressed through the England Men's Pathway as previous captain of
the U18 and U19 sides, making his U20 debut in the 2025 Six Nations before his U19 caps this
spring. He's been described by teammates as 'driven... very competitive' and says he wants
to pay back the sacrifices made by family and friends for investing in is rugby journey.
